School Highlights
Southern Careers Institute-San Antonio serves 1,396 students (100% of students are full-time).
Minority enrollment is 70%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the state average of 74%.

Student Body
The student population of Southern Careers Institute-San Antonio has grown by 226% over five years.
The Southern Careers Institute-San Antonio diversity score of 0.63 is less than the state average of 0.70. The school's diversity has declined by 5% over five years.
